Historic Structures of Chiropractic Care



How did the historical structures shape the evolution of chiropractic care?

Well, back in the late 19th century, chiropractic care emerged as a distinct healthcare career based on the belief that appropriate alignment of the body's musculoskeletal framework can enable the body to recover itself without surgery or medicine. The owner, D.D. Palmer, highlighted the partnership in between the spinal column and total health, laying the groundwork wherefore would become modern chiropractic practices.

At first, chiropractic care faced apprehension from typical doctors. Nevertheless, with time, as even more people experienced the advantages of chiropractic care adjustments, the field acquired acknowledgment and approval. The emphasis on natural healing, back positioning, and all natural methods reverberated with people seeking options to standard medication.

The historical structures of chiropractic care set the stage for its development into a widely accepted practice today.
